Job Title: Application and Integration Developer
About the Role
We are seeking a skilled and motivated Application and Integration Developer to join our development team. In this role, you will support the design, development, and integration of modern applications and data solutions across our enterprise ecosystem.
The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with both front-end and back-end development, data integration, and cloud-based practices—particularly within Microsoft Azure. You will be instrumental in deploying Azure App Services to host React SPAs and ASP.NET Core Web APIs, integrating with Azure SQL Databases using Entity Framework Core, automating deployments via Azure DevOps CI/CD pipelines, and working with iPaaS platforms to support scalable, cloud-native integrations.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and maintain responsive web applications using modern front-end frameworks.
- Build and consume RESTful APIs using ASP.NET Core and C#.
- Design and implement data integration workflows across SQL Server, Oracle, and Azure SQL.
- Integrate cloud and on-premise systems using iPaaS tools (e.g., Boomi, Azure Logic Apps, Mulesoft, etc.).
- Deploy and manage Azure App Services for hosting APIs and React-based SPAs.
- Build and maintain CI/CD pipelines in Azure DevOps for automated build, test, and deployment.
- Utilize deployment slots for zero-downtime releases and staging validations.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ate systems and streamline data flow.
- Work with data engineers to support analytics and lakehouse architecture.
- Document and test APIs and services using Postman, Swagger, and SSDT.
